  2. Hace 6 días · The Grand Duchy of Hesse and by Rhine ( German: Großherzogtum Hessen und bei Rhein) was a grand duchy in western Germany that existed from 1806 to 1918. The grand duchy originally formed from the Landgraviate of Hesse-Darmstadt in 1806 as the Grand Duchy of Hesse (German: Großherzogtum Hessen ). It assumed the name Hesse und bei Rhein in 1816 ...

  6. 9 de may. de 2024 · The garden’s most striking feature, the baroque palace building, was constructed in the early 1700s. Later, the adjoining garden we see today was designed under Ernst Ludwig, Landgrave of Hesse-Darmstadt. But for a long time, this park was inaccessible to the public.
